HPS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2024 in Review

72 of the 7,592 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in John Hancock Preferred Income Fund III (HPS) for Q4 2024, worth a combined $60.5M — down 4% from $63M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 19 funds opened new HPS positions and 7 closed out — a net gain of 12 holders — while 16 added to existing stakes and 12 trimmed.

The largest buyer was LPL Financial, adding an estimated $1.79M. The largest seller was Global Retirement Partners, cutting an estimated $918K.
